Art and History of Colmar, Strasbourg and Basel 17th - 21st October 2024

Our recent trip to Colmar, Strasbourg and Basel was a vertiable feast of art and architecture.

Our first full day; Friday 18th October saw us in Strasbourg for a morning at the Musee des Beaux-Arts and the Musee des Arts Decoratifs situation in the 18th century Palais de Rohan.  Art works covering Raphael, Botticelli and El Greco were explored, together with the interior design of the Palais.  This was followed, in the afternoon by a visit to the Cathedral of Notre Dame, which dates back to 1015 and is an outstanding piece of Gothic architecture.  Then a walking tour of old Strasbourg along the picturesque waterways and the houses of Le Petit France.

Saturday was spent in Colmar, taking the walking tour through the old town to 'Little Venice' with lovely half-timbered houses lining the canal and back via the Gothic church of St. Martin.  The afternoon was spent at the Musee d'Unterlinden for a guided tour of the art work in this 13th century Dominican convent including the Isenheim Altarpiece by Matthias Grunewald which depicts Christ on the Cross.

On Sunday we visited the Beyeler Foundation, near Basel, which holds the art collection of Hildy and Ernst Beyeler and covers classical, modern and contemporary works including pieces by Giacometti, Picasso and Monet.  The afternoon was spent at the Kunstmuseum in Basel, which is the largest and most significant public art collection in Switzerland ranging from Old Masters to Picasso and in the building paintings by Kline, Newman and Rothko.,

Monday was the day of our return to the UK, however not before we had a morning in Freiburg to look at the Cathedral, the market square and then board our coach for the trip home.

A stunning art inspired 5 days.

Many of the art works in the Sainsbury Centre are by 20th century artists who lived in Paris.  They participated in an intense and innovative era of creativity.  We will look at works by Picasso, Modigliani, Zadkine, Giacometti and others, and discuss the connections, friendships and rivalries between them.

Our guide: Polly Gould.  Polly has been a guide at the Sainsbury Centre since 2007 and has a second degree in History of Art at UEA.

On Your Doorstep -- St Mary's Church Houghton on The Hill

Hidden down a bridleway close to Peddars Way in the rural Norfolk Brecks, the church of St. Mary, Houghton-on-the-Hill is one of the most remarkable early churches in East Anglia.

The fact that it has survived from this deserted medieval village, and with it maybe the oldest large-scale religious wall paintings in Britain is nothing short of a miracle.

Step inside and be captivated by the paintings on all four walls of the nave, paintings which are some of the earliest and best in the country.

Our first ‘ON YOUR DOORSTEP’ venture will be to the theatre at Westacre, to hear Historian, Lucy Adlington discuss her very successful book, ‘The Dressmakers of Auschwitz’.

’25 young, Jewish inmates of Auschwitz-Birkenau were selected to create beautiful fashions for élite Nazi women, in a dedicated salon established by the camp-commandant’s wife. Historian, Lucy Adlington was able to interview the last surviving seamstress and her book, ‘The Dressmakers of Auschwitz’ is a remarkable story of resilience, camaraderie, quiet heroism and skill.’

Exclusive visit to Knebworth House followed by a guided tour of St Albans Cathedral.

Booking is now open for our exclusive visit to Knebworth House followed by a guided tour of St Albans Cathedral.

We are lucky to have a member connected with the Lytton Cobbold family who has been able to arrange an exclusive visit to Knebworth House which will be closed to the public on the day of our visit.We will be greeted by Lord Lytton Cobbold who will give us an introductory talk about the family and house followed by a guided tour.


After a light lunch there are the gardens to explore as well as 3 exhibition spaces:

  • The Lytton family in India
  • On location at Knebworth House
  • Rock concert history of Knebworth Park

We will then travel to St Albans Cathedral for 1700 hundred years of history where we will have a guided tour.  The highlights include Britains longest nave, a stunning collection of medieval wall paintings, two beautifully restored medieval shrines and a Norman crossing tower.
